The paper presents results of determination of sound wave direction based on signals from first-order ambisonic microphone. The experiment consisted in recording the test signals with the SoundField microphone positioned in the axis of the turntable in the anechoic chamber. The spherical coordinates of the sound intensity vector were calculated with use of three different conceptual and numerical approaches and were compared to actual values resulting from the geometry of the system. Accuracy of the localization of the sound source depending on the frequencies and the method for determination of the spherical coordinates as well as on the time constant and the parameters of the signal recording was presented. The obtained results show the effectiveness of the calculation methods used for localization of the sound source.
